What Are The Advantages Of Digital Over Analog?

What Are The Advantages Of Digital Over Analog? Negligible or zero distortion due to noise during transmission. The rate of transmission is higher. Multidirectional transmission concurrently and longer distance transmission is possible. Video, Audio, and Text messages can be translated into the device language. What Is Function Of Digital Computer?

What Is Function Of Digital Computer? digital computer, any of a class of devices capable of solving problems by processing information in discrete form.
